The ABOM Exam is the certification examination offered by the American Board of Obesity Medicine (ABOM). It is designed to assess physicians' knowledge and competency in the practice of obesity medicine. Passing the exam and earning ABOM diplomate status demonstrates that a physician has met rigorous standards and hold specialized expertise in obesity care.

The OMA's Review Course for the ABOM Exam counts for 12 of the 30 GROUP ONE CME credits required to sit for the exam. When bundled with the Additional Study Courses (19 CME/CE), physicians can earn 31 of the required 30 GROUP ONE credits.
For the current exam cycle, GROUP ONE credits include any AMA PRA Category 1 Credit™ offered by ABOM’s Primary Obesity Medicine CME partners, including the Obesity Medicine Association.
-
All 60 CME credits must be earned within 36 months prior to the application deadline.
